In vivo rodent studies have investigated BPC-157 across gastrointestinal ulcer models, tendon and ligament transection models, and peripheral nerve injury paradigms, with research examining angiogenesis and new-vessel and granulation-tissue formation in both gastrointestinal mucosa and musculoskeletal tissue [3][4], alongside collagen deposition kinetics and, in a separate body of central nervous system work, dopaminergic and serotonergic system dynamics, following both systemic and local administration
Unlike many peptides used in research, BPC-157 has been described in the published literature as stable in human gastric juice without enzymatic degradation, and as effective in research models when administered without a delivery carrier
